Transaction 20dd046bdd36ff3a1a3248f8f44fec140d206bae6e732dc88396b4989ad23c99
1 Input
2 Outputs
- 20dd046bdd36ff3a1a3248f8f44fec140d206bae6e732dc88396b4989ad23c99:0
- 20dd046bdd36ff3a1a3248f8f44fec140d206bae6e732dc88396b4989ad23c99:1
value 2239000
address 13MspDMWYopwKffQLZWwT95XNDQmPpctVs
value 667638
address 17ENjrLZcHQFgZY8RMAo7r71FBCse8RNYM